Insulation sleeves are used to cover the joints made at the coil ends and coil leads. It gives
physical protection to joints and also provides insulation. They come in rigid and flexible types.
They are available for standard wire sizes.
Insulation paper : A variety of insulating papers are available specifically designed for insulating
electrical circuits. In motors it is used to insulate the slots, in between coils. Following are the
most often used insulating materials: Leatheriod paper, Press pan paper, Manila or hemp paper,
Triflexil paper, Asbestos paper, Micanite paper
Insulation cloth : It is inserted between the coils after they are placed in slots. Sometimes it is
also used as slot liner. Empire cloth, Asbestos cloth, Glass cloth, Mica cloth, Micanite- cloth are
some of the types.
1.7. INSULATION MATERIALS:
Leathroid paper : These papers are pressed form of a non-woven fabric of fibres from good
and tough wood. It is available from 0.05mm thickness. It is sold as rolls in meters. Generally
used for low voltage machines. This A-grade insulating material is mainly used as insulation in
electrical appliances, machineries, and power equipments.
NOMEX : NOMEX is widely used in a majority of electrical equipments. It is used in almost
every known electrical sheet insulation application. Available in various thicknesses with a density
from 0.9 to 1.0, NOMEX is ideal choice to use as slot insulation in hand-wound motors and for
covering of coils, and is also used in other applications such as folded or punched parts. It is
also widely preferred as sheet insulation in fluid filled transformer applications due to its improved
impregnability. Dielectric strength of NOMEX ranges from 24 to 30 kV/mm. This is Insulation
class F (155 °C) materials.
The NOMEX sheet can be used with virtually all classes of electrical varnishes and adhesives
(polyimides, silicones, epoxies, polyesters, acrylics, phenolics, synthetic rubbers), Resins quickly
penetrate and pass through the sheet to form a cohesive bond between motor end turns. Due to
its stiff structure it can be quickly and easily inserted between coils. Mechanical toughness of
the sheet helps to keep the shape of the insulation intact during motor assembly. NOMEX is able
to maintain its insulation properties over a long period even if it is subjected to temperature
variations. This assures proper insulation between phases and gives good reliability for the
motors. NOMEX sheets can also be used with transformer fluids (mineral and silicone oils and
other synthetics) and with lubricating oils and refrigerants used in hermetic systems. Common
industrial solvents (alcohols, ketones, acetone, toluene, xylene) have a slight softening and
swelling effect on NOMEX paper, similar to that of water. These effects are largely reversible
when the solvent is removed. The Limiting Oxygen Index,LOI, (ASTM D-2863) of NOMEX paper
at room temperature ranges between 27 and 32% (depending on thickness and density).
Materials with LOI above 21% (ambient air) will not support combustion.
